Transaction 04e0561e506c9c4e1839d8603985cca302812a5654a3a39b66f06578798e1330

1 Input
2 Outputs
  • 04e0561e506c9c4e1839d8603985cca302812a5654a3a39b66f06578798e1330:0
  • value  16629624
    address  37LiuiFe8TRJCCkG7DJwvs5beQBgV1twaz
  • 04e0561e506c9c4e1839d8603985cca302812a5654a3a39b66f06578798e1330:1
  • value  1183270376
    address  1CrUTbad16Eo8BU54cqzEEMpDTFswYSQA7